Course objectives
The aim of the course is to offer a possibility for self-understanding through exercises and games in a social group and to show the potentialities of personal development especially in relation to teachers profession and group management.
Learning outcomes
At the end of this course the students will be able to:
- interpret the term social skill and describe the specifics of social skills in the context of a teacher
- define the specifics of social skills of a PE teacher
- diagnose a target group
- choose and aplly a suitable activity in order to develop specific skills of a given target group
Syllabus
  • Introduction into social skills
  • Social perception
  • Effective communication within education process (verbal, non-verbal)
  • Presentation skills
  • Group work - cohesion, tension
  • Cooperation
  • Conflict and how to solve it
  • Feedback - provision and acceptation
